SOURCE: Printscreen will not print

In the old DOS days, Print Screen would send a copy of the screen to the printer.

In Windows, Print Screen sends a copy to the Clip Board.
So, what you need to do is open an application like WordPad, MS Word, Paint or some other program and Paste to a new file. Then you can print the image from that file.

A side note: The PrintScreen key captures the whole screen, the ALT-PrintScreen key combination captures only the active window.

SOURCE: How can I use Print Screen

Print Screen
Use this method to print screen.
Press and hold down the Alt key and the press the PrtSc key, this places thescreen image into the Clipboard. .
Open a blank Word document and then Click on Edit - Paste.
The image is then places onto this page, you can up the image by holdingdown the Shift key and then place the cursor on the bottom corner of the image,then press the left mouse button and drag it down to the right, release themouse button when you have d the image to your requirements.
NOTE - Holding down the Shift button will maintain the image in the correctproportion.
You can now print this image document and or add text before printing.

Dv7 3065dx

You need to press PrtScr or Print Screen button to capture the screen to the clip board. I believe on your laptop you need to hold the fn key down to select it. On the bottom left of the keyboard is a key that has fn on it. Any key on your keyboard that has a second function will need the fn key to access this second option. PrtScr button should be on the top row right hand side of the keyboard with a box drawn around it.

Hold down the fn key and press the PrtScr key and then you can paste it into a document or paint or whatever. The PrintScreen function works in all versions of windows I have ever used, from Windows 3.11 for workgroups to Windows 8.
